Transaction 434fd05836a97f829b1c0019ebaa31d5bb5c4e0e5392c51a8df4e1250a427c67
1 Input
1 Output
-
434fd05836a97f829b1c0019ebaa31d5bb5c4e0e5392c51a8df4e1250a427c67:0
- value
- 650556
- script pubkey
- OP_0 OP_PUSHBYTES_20 45e65ae9b86d663bb3ced21280f64e36c1369112
- address
- bc1qghn946dcd4nrhv7w6gfgpajwxmqndygjgegvzz